引言
增强现实(Augmented Reality,简称AR)和混合现实(Mixed Reality,简称MR)是近年来备受关注的科技领域。它们通过在现实世界中叠加虚拟信息,为用户提供了全新的交互体验。本文将详细介绍AR技术,并提供一份MR培训教程,帮助读者轻松掌握这些前沿技能,为未来职场做好准备。
一、AR技术概述
1.1 定义
AR技术是一种将虚拟信息叠加到现实世界中的技术。它通过摄像头捕捉现实世界的图像,并在这些图像上叠加虚拟对象,使虚拟对象与现实世界中的物体共存。
1.2 工作原理
AR技术主要依赖于以下三个关键技术:
- 摄像头捕捉:通过摄像头捕捉现实世界的图像。
- 图像识别:对捕捉到的图像进行识别和分析。
- 叠加虚拟信息:在识别出的图像上叠加虚拟对象。
1.3 应用领域
AR技术在教育、医疗、零售、娱乐等多个领域都有广泛应用,以下是一些典型的应用案例:
- 教育:通过AR技术,学生可以直观地了解抽象概念,如人体结构、历史事件等。
- 医疗:医生可以利用AR技术进行手术模拟,提高手术成功率。
- 零售:商家可以通过AR技术展示产品,提高用户体验和购买意愿。
二、MR培训教程
2.1 基础知识学习
- 了解AR/VR/MR技术的基本概念和区别。
- 学习相关的编程语言,如Unity、C#、Java等。
- 掌握3D建模和动画制作技能。
2.2 开发环境搭建
- 安装Unity或其他AR开发平台。
- 学习如何使用ARKit、ARCore等AR开发工具。
2.3 项目实践
- 创建简单的AR应用,如AR游戏、AR广告等。
- 参与开源项目,积累实际开发经验。
2.4 高级技能提升
- 学习AR技术在特定领域的应用,如医疗、教育等。
- 掌握AR/VR/MR项目的项目管理、团队协作等技能。
三、下载即学资源推荐
3.1 在线教程
- 《Unity ARKit开发实战》:这是一本针对Unity开发者,详细介绍如何使用ARKit进行AR应用开发的书籍。
- 《混合现实:原理与应用》:本书全面介绍了混合现实技术的原理和应用,适合对MR技术感兴趣的读者。
3.2 视频教程
- YouTube频道:搜索“AR开发教程”或“MR开发教程”,可以找到大量的免费视频教程。
- Bilibili频道:国内视频平台Bilibili上也有许多优质的AR/VR/MR教程。
3.3 实践项目
- GitHub项目:在GitHub上搜索AR或VR相关项目,可以找到许多开源项目,学习他人的代码和经验。
四、总结
AR技术作为一种新兴的科技,正在改变着我们的生活和工作方式。通过本文的介绍,相信读者已经对AR技术有了初步的了解。希望这份MR培训教程能够帮助读者轻松掌握AR技术,为未来职场做好准备。
